Abstract

In order to meet the global competition and the survival of products in the market a new way of thinking is necessary to change and improve the existing technology and to develop products at economical price. It means not only to invest in procuring new equipments but also effectively control the process variables involved in any manufacturing process. These process variables must be measured, controlled and optimized to get the desired and valuable outputs. The typical process parameters for a welding process which affect the desired output for a welding process are welding speed, arc voltage, welding current etc. The weld process parameters vary for the different type of the welding process chosen. Optimization of the welding process parameters depends upon the ability to measure and control the process variables involved in the welding process. The scope of the paper is to review the state of art of optimization techniques to be used for welding.
